My personal pick among these is Konami. It felt like they actively tried to sever all goodwill with their original fanbase and talented devs in favor of pachinko. Then when they try to make amends, they half-ass it with disastrous results(Metal Gear Survive AND Contra Rogue Corps). Let's not forget their orwellian and downright hateful treatment of workers. Any underperforming staff are demoted to blue-collar jobs; anyone who leaves is put on a blacklist to prevent migration to other studios.
